Japanese[edit]
Kanji[edit]
洮
- cleanse
- a river in Gansu province, a tributary of the Yellow River
Readings[edit]
- Go-on: とう (tō)←たう (tau, historical); どう (dō)←だう (dau, historical)
- Kan-on: とう (tō)←たう (tau, historical)
Usage notes[edit]
This character does not appear to be used in modern Japanese. Not listed in most Japanese references.[1][2][3][4][5]
The character is listed in the Kanwa Dai Jisho of 1914,[6] only giving on'yomi pronunciations, and the given citations are all from Chinese texts interpreted into Japanese using the 漢文訓読 (kanbun kundoku) method.
